Here's to you Mr. Spandex Leg Shaver Register But Never Finish Bike Racer!

A Blog devoted to Devin's dream of finishing bike races.  In the DNF category Devin is always a winner.  Devin Now Finishes or Devin Never Finishes. DNF.

Wednesday, 13 August 2008

Devin, the President saw your last race and wanted to let you know you did a good job...

President George Bush (C), first lady Laura Bush (L) and their ...

Aww, he is cute without his helmet and protective goggles.

No comments: